Job summary

Ababil Healthcare in Chennai is seeking an embedded DSP Engineer to implement algorithms in C/C++ for real-time ECG processing.

You will translate MATLAB/Python prototypes into optimized embedded code, validate against real ECG datasets, and work closely with firmware and QA teams to ensure robust signals and accurate heart-rate analytics.

Strong fundamentals in C/C++, memory management, and DSP concepts are required, with a passion for biomedical signal processing and healthcare technology.

Job description

  1. The role involves implementing DSP algorithms in C/C++ for real-time and embedded environments.
  2. Responsibilities include ECG filtering, QRS/R-peak detection, heart-rate computation, and basic beat analysis.
  3. Candidates will translate MATLAB/Python prototypes into efficient embedded C/C++ code.
  4. The engineer will work with real ECG datasets and perform algorithm validation using standard performance metrics.
  5. Strong fundamentals in C/C++, pointers, memory management, and data structures are required.
  6. Basic knowledge of DSP concepts such as FIR/IIR filters, FFT, and sampling theory is expected.
  7. Familiarity with ECG morphology (P, QRS, T waves) and noise sources is highly desirable.
  8. The role includes debugging, optimization, documentation, and collaboration with firmware and QA teams.
  9. This position is ideal for candidates passionate about biomedical signal processing and healthcare technology.
